How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hoboken?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hoboken Studio Apartments | $3,678 | $1,595 | $10,000+ |
| Hoboken 1 Bedroom Apartments | $4,285 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| Hoboken 2 Bedroom Apartments | $5,338 | $1,500 | $10,000+ |
| Hoboken 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,799 | $2,295 | $10,000+ |
| Hoboken 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,751 | $2,350 | $10,000+ |
| Hoboken 5 Bedroom Apartments | $9,988 | $3,250 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Hoboken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Hoboken with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Hoboken is at 53 Cooper Pl listed at $985.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Hoboken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Hoboken is $4,285.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Hoboken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Hoboken is a 1,300 square feet unit starting from $1,900 at FOUND Study Chelsea- Student/Intern.
What is the average size for Hoboken 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Hoboken is currently 780 sq ft.
